Lizette Cloete is an Occupational Therapist who graduated from the University of Pretoria, South Africa, in 1992. With her extensive knowledge and experience, she has become a leading expert in dementia care.
Lizette's dedication to her profession is evident through her many accomplishments. In 2023, she was awarded a grant from the Alzheimer’s Resource Coordination Centre for her innovative program “The Complete Dementia Navigation System”. She is a FitMinds Cognitive Coach who helps people with cognitive loss maintain their cognitive status and delay decline. She served on the South Carolina Occupational Therapy Association's and the Parkinson's Group of the Ozarks' Boards of Directors.
.She has helped individuals all over the world with challenging dementia behaviors, including in South Africa, Kenya, Australia, the United Kingdom, Singapore, and the Philippines.
